Abstract

The invention discloses novel thermal insulation mortar. The novel thermal insulation mortar comprises the following components in percentage by weight: 5-30 parts of white cement, 60-100 parts of lightweight aggregate, 10-40 parts of quartz sand, 0.1-0.5 part of cellulose ether, 0.1-0.5 part of redispersible latex powder, 0.05-0.3 part of citric acid, 0.1-0.3 part of reinforcing fibers, 30-90 parts of acrylic elastic emulsion and 60-100 parts of water. Due to the improvement on the components of the thermal insulation mortar, the novel thermal insulation mortar has very good thermal insulation property, and is good in workability and high in strength, and thus brings about obvious improvement in the field of the modern building energy-saving materials.

Description

A kind of novel thermal insulation mortar
Technical field
The present invention relates to a kind of technical field of mortar, be specifically related to a kind of novel thermal insulation mortar.
Background technology
Energy-conserving and environment-protective are one of fundamental state policies of China, and therefore country is advancing the environmental protection and energy saving requirement to buildings, and in order to reach relevant energy conservation standard, buildings generally all will carry out the construction of thermal insulation layer.Traditional lagging material is expansion polyphenyl plate, extruded polystyrene board and polyurathamc etc., although its thermal conductivity is less, heat-insulating property is excellent, but it is as organic insulation material, fire resistance is poor, and in recent years, a lot of serious fire that cause because of the organic insulation material that ignites have occurred in China, therefore, a lot of areas start to widely popularize inorganic heat insulation mortar.
Summary of the invention
Goal of the invention: the object of the invention is, in order to make up the deficiencies in the prior art, provides a kind of novel thermal insulation mortar.
The technical solution used in the present invention: a kind of novel thermal insulation mortar, its formula comprises following component by weight: 5~30 parts of white cements, 60~100 parts of light skeletals, 10~40 parts of quartz sands, 0.1~0.5 part of ether of cellulose, 0.1~0.5 part of redispersable latex powder, 0.05~0.3 part of citric acid, 0.1~0.3 part of fortifying fibre, 30~90 parts of acrylic elastic emulsion, 60~100 parts, water.
Its formula comprises following component by weight: 15 parts of white cements, 75 parts of light skeletals, 30 parts of quartz sands, 0.3 part of ether of cellulose, 0.35 part of redispersable latex powder, 0.15 part of citric acid, 0.2 part of fortifying fibre, 60 parts of acrylic elastic emulsion, 80 parts, water.
Described light skeletal is one or both in pearlstone and glass bead.
Described fortifying fibre is polypropylene fibre.
Beneficial effect: the present invention, by the improvement to thermal insulation mortar component, makes it have extraordinary heat-insulating property, and has good workability, and intensity is high, for having brought significant progress in modern architecture energy-saving material field.
